--- marp: true paginate: true math: mathjax theme: buutti title: N. Example Lecture --- # Example Lecture ## Section - This line appears instantly * This line appears by pressing spacebar * This line has an inline code `variable` ```js console.log("Here's a coloured JavaScript code block"); console.log("Remember indentation so it's revealed after the bullet point."); ``` * This line has an inline LaTeX maths equation $c = \frac{a^2}{\sqrt{b}}$ * Here's a maths block: $$ F(x) = \int_a^b f(x) dx $$ ## Columns
![](imgs/buuttilogo.png) * Basic image example
![width:800px](imgs/buuttilogo.png) * Wider image
* This line is outside the columns and goes from left all the way to the right ## Setup * In VS Code, install the extensions * [Marp for VS code](https://marketplace.visualstudio.com/items?itemName=marp-team.marp-vscode) * So you can see the slideshow preview when editing. * [Markdown all in one](https://marketplace.visualstudio.com/items?itemName=yzhang.markdown-all-in-one) * [Markdown table formatter](https://marketplace.visualstudio.com/items?itemName=fcrespo82.markdown-table-formatter) * *Right click > Format document* makes tables pretty * [Save and run](https://marketplace.visualstudio.com/items?itemName=wk-j.save-and-run) * An HTML version of the lecture is created on save * See [settings.json](./.vscode/settings.json) * Add filenames to `notMatch` if a HTML on save is not needed